A recent network and server replacement at work has has left me with new kit that basically has had most of the decent windows functionality tampered with.

One of the results is this pop up message appearing every time a webpage I'm trying to view has a script error:

-------

A run time error has occurred.
Do you wish to Debug

Line #
Error: Expected ('.........')

-------

Any one know how to turn this little devil off - it is beggining to get on my wick.

Assuming you're talking about IE here, have you tried ...

Tools>Internet Options>Advanced

and, under the 'browsing' tab, check the status of 'Disable script debugging' and 'Display a notification about every script error'?
